charset=UTF-8; format=flowed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it X-MBO-RS-ID: 2b7b03ec44f958831f6 X-MBO-RS-META: d7cbac4yirg6dmrd4f7ehr3mnryd66c3 On 10/23/25 3:16 PM, Sudeep Holla wrote: Hello Sudeep, >> + arm,poll-transport: >> + type: boolean >> + description: >> + An optional property which unconditionally forces polling in all transports. >> + This is mainly mean to work around uncooperative SCP, which does not generate >> + completion interrupts. >> + > > Could you please clarify which platform and transport this change pertains to? Renesas X5H with older SCP firmware , accessible via mailbox. > Introducing a property that enforces unconditional polling across all > platforms is not ideal - particularly if this is intended as a workaround > for a platform- or firmware- specific issue. Such implementations often get > replicated across platforms without addressing the root cause, leading to > wider inconsistencies. The root cause is being addressed already, this is meant to keep the older SCP version operable. > It would be preferable to scope this behavior using the platform’s compatible > string. This approach ensures the workaround is applied only to the affected > platform and prevents it from being inadvertently enabled elsewhere, unless > another platform intentionally uses the same compatible string (which seems > unlikely). This is not platform-specific issue. SCMI provider which fails to generate interrupts can appear on any platform, using either transport, that is why I made the property generic. -- Best regards, Marek Vasut
